A truck crashed into a Vandalia home over the weekend, and one resident says a dog was to blame.
The crash was reported in the 3100 block of Stop 8 Road around 4:17 p.m. on Sunday.
A 52-year-old man told police he had just gotten home, and another resident had let their dog out to see him.
